数字电压表设计课程设计
东 北 石 油 大 学
课 程 设 计
2
东北石油大学课程设计任务书
课程 硬件课程设计
题目 数字电压表设计
专业
主要内容、基本要求等
一、主要内容:
利用EL教学实验箱、微机和QuartusⅡ软件系统,使用VHDL语言输入设计。电子设计自动化技术EDA的发展给电子系统的设计带来了革命性的变化,EDA软件设计工具,硬件描述语言,可编程逻辑器件(PLD)使得EDA技术的应用走向普及。CPLD是新型的可编程逻辑器件,采用CPLD进行产品开发可以灵活地进行模块配置,大大缩短了产品开发周期,也有利于产品向小型化,集成化的方向发展。而 VHDL语言是EDA的关键技术之一,它采用自顶向下的设计方法,完成系统的整体设计。本文用CPLD芯片和VHDL语言设计了一个八位的数字电压表。? 关键词:数字电压表;QuartusⅡ软件;EDA(电子设计自动化)
目 录
第1章 概 述 1
1.1 EDA的概念 1
1.2 EDA技术及应用 2
1.3 EDA硬件工作平台 2
1.4 EDA的软件工作平台 2
第2章 数字电压表的设计实现 3
2.1状态机 3
2.2状态机的设计 3
2.3 BCD码的转换 5
2.4七段电路显示 7
第3章 数字电压表的测试与运行 10
3.1数字电压表的编译与仿真 10
3.2数字电压表的仿真与烧写 12
结论 15
参考文献 16
第1章 概 述
1.1 EDA的概念
EDA是电子设计自动化(Electronic Design Automation)的缩写。由于它是一门刚刚发展起来的新技术,涉及面广,内容丰富,理解各异,所以目前尚无一个确切的定义[1]。但从EDA技术的几个主要方面的内容来看,可以理解为:EDA技术是以大规模可编程逻辑器件为设计载体,以硬件描述语言为系统逻辑描述的主要表达方式,以计算机、大规模可编程逻辑器件的开发软件及实验开发系统为设计工具,通过有关的开发软件,自动完成用软件的方式设计电子系统到硬件系统的一门新技术。可以实现逻辑编译、逻辑化简、逻辑分割、逻辑综合及优化,逻辑布局布线、逻辑仿真[2]。
EDA技术是伴随着计算机、集成电路、电子系统的设计发展起来的,至今已有30多年的历程。大致可以分为三个发展阶段。20世纪70年代的CAD(计算机辅助设计)阶段:这一阶段的主要特征是利用计算机辅助进行电路原理图编辑,PCB不同布线,使得设计师从传统高度重复繁杂的绘图劳动中解脱出来。[3]20世纪80年代的QAE(计算机辅助工程设计)阶段:这一阶段的主要特征是以逻辑摸拟、定时分析、故障仿真、自动布局布线为核心,重点解决电路设计的功能检测等问题,使设计能在产品制作之前预知产品的功能与性能[4]。20世纪90年代是EDA(电子设计自动化)阶段:这一阶段的主要特征是以高级描述语言,系统级仿真和综合技术为特点,采用“自顶向下”的设计理念,将设计前期的许多高层次设计由EDA工具来完成。
EDA是电子技术设计自动化,也就是能够帮助人们设计电子电路或系统的软件工具。该工具可以在电子产品的各个设计阶段发挥作用,使设计更复杂的电路和系统成为可能。在原理图设计阶段,可以使用EDA中的仿真工具论证设计的正确性;在芯片设计阶段,可以使用EDA中的芯片设计工具设计制作芯片的版图;在电路板设计阶段,可以使用EDA中电路板设计工具设计多层电路板。特别是支持硬件描述语言的EDA工具的出现,使复杂数字系统设计自动化成为可能,只要用硬件描述语言将数字系统的行为描述正确,就可以进行该数字系统的芯片设计与制造[5]。21世纪将是EDA技术的高速发展期,EDA技术将是对21世纪产生重大影响的十大技术之一。 硬件描述语言:硬件描述语言(HDL)是一种用于进行电子系统硬件设计的计算机高级语言,它采用软件的设计方法来描述电子系统的逻辑功能、电路结构和连接形式。?常用硬件描述语言有HDL、Verilog和VHDL语言。
1.2 EDA技术及应用
电子EDA技术发展迅猛,逐渐在教学、科研、产品设计与制造等各方面都发挥着巨大的作用。在教学方面:几乎所有理工科(特别是电子信息)类的高校都开设了EDA课程。主要是让学生了解EDA的基本原理和基本概念、硬件描述系统逻辑的方法、使用EDA工具进行电子电路课程的模拟仿真实验并在作毕业设计时从事简单电子系统的设计,为今后工作打下基础。[6]具有代表性的是全国每两年举办一次的大学生电子设计竞赛活动。在科研方面:主要利用电路仿真工具进行电路设计与仿真;利用虚拟仪器进行产品调试;将FPGA器件的开发应用到仪器设备中[7]。在产品设计与制造方面:从高性能的微处理器、数字信号处理器
您可能关注的文档
- 教师用书2016_2017版高中生物第5章生物的进化第2节第3节进化性变化是怎样发生的探索生物进化的历史学案.doc
- 教师的诗意生活与专业成长读后感.doc
- 教学简笔画-风景与建筑篇.ppt
- 教师资格《中学综合素质》考前冲刺试卷五.doc
- 教师证教育知识与能力作文例文阅读.doc
- 教师资格统考预测试卷(小学).doc
- 教师基本功写字培训(修改版):粉笔字学习课堂第一课.pptx
- 教案17-建筑详图.doc
- 教案三 计算机网络的传输介质.ppt
- 教科版九年级物理电磁课上用.ppt
- 2026新版人教版六年级下册数学期末考试卷(3套打印版含答案解析).docx
- 近5年高考英语高频词汇短语汇编(真题版).docx
- 2026新版人教版二年级下册语文期末考试卷(3套打印版含答案解析).docx
- 2026新版人教版五年级下册数学期末考试卷(3套打印版含答案解析).docx
- 2026新版人教版一年级下册语文期末考试卷(3套打印版含答案解析).docx
- 2026新版人教版四年级下册数学期末考试卷(3套打印版含答案解析).docx
- 2026新版人教版一年级上册语文期末考试卷(3套打印版含答案解析).docx
- 2026新版人教版四年级上册数学期末考试卷(3套打印版含答案解析).docx
- 2026部编人教版小学六年级语文上册阅读理解真题专项练习(附答案解析).docx
- 2026新版人教版三年级上册语文期末考试卷(3套打印版含答案解析).docx
最近下载
- 高等机构学01螺旋理论基础讲义.ppt
- 基于plc的清洗消毒机控制系统设计 .pdf VIP
- 发明专利说明书范例.pdf VIP
- 人教版英语中考九年级话题复习中国传统节日Chinesetraditionalfestivals教学设计.docx VIP
- 四年级道德与法治下册第一单元单元整体教学设计.pdf VIP
- 进修汇报医生课件课件.pptx VIP
- 03G102钢结构设计制图深度和表示方法(高清版) (OCR).pdf VIP
- 基于三菱PLC的自动洗碗机控制系统设计.doc VIP
- 下肢深静脉血栓形成介入治疗护理实践指南(2025)解读PPT课件.pptx VIP
- 南京新港东区建设发展有限公司南京龙潭新城花园路等13条道路及花园河等4条河道工程项目环评报告表(报批稿).pdf VIP
原创力文档

文档评论(0)